# SPDX-License-Identifier: (GPL-2.0-only OR BSD-2-Clause)
%YAML 1.2
---
$id: http://devicetree.org/schemas/pinctrl/qcom,msm8660-pinctrl.yaml#
$schema: http://devicetree.org/meta-schemas/core.yaml#
title: Qualcomm MSM8660 TLMM pin controller
maintainers:
- Bjorn Andersson <andersson@kernel.org>
- Krzysztof Kozlowski <krzk@kernel.org>
description:
Top Level Mode Multiplexer pin controller in Qualcomm MSM8660 SoC.
properties:
compatible:
const: qcom,msm8660-pinctrl
reg:
maxItems: 1
interrupts:
maxItems: 1
gpio-reserved-ranges:
minItems: 1
maxItems: 86
gpio-line-names:
maxItems: 173
patternProperties:
"-state$":
oneOf:
- $ref: "#/$defs/qcom-msm8660-tlmm-state"
- patternProperties:
"-pins$":
$ref: "#/$defs/qcom-msm8660-tlmm-state"
additionalProperties: false
$defs:
qcom-msm8660-tlmm-state:
type: object
description:
Pinctrl node's client devices use subnodes for desired pin configuration.
Client device subnodes use below standard properties.
$ref: qcom,tlmm-common.yaml#/$defs/qcom-tlmm-state
unevaluatedProperties: false
properties:
pins:
description:
List of gpio pins affected by the properties specified in this
subnode.
items:
oneOf:
- pattern: "^gpio([0-9]|[1-9][0-9]|1[0-6][0-9]|17[0-2])$"
- enum: [ sdc3_clk, sdc3_cmd, sdc3_data, sdc4_clk, sdc4_cmd, sdc4_data ]
minItems: 1
maxItems: 36
function:
description:
Specify the alternative function to be configured for the specified
pins.
